The War of Water and Fire and the Transformation of Heaven and Earth
Water Fire Duel: The Collapse and Reconstruction of Order in Mythology

Since Pangu created the world and N ü wa created humans, the order between heaven and earth was initially established, and the gods each performed their duties. However, the jealousy and dissatisfaction in the hearts of the Water God Gonggong grew stronger and stronger. He had long coveted the power of the Fire God Zhurong to control light and warmth, and finally couldn't hold back. He led his troops of shrimp and crab to launch a grand attack on the Fire God.
At the beginning of the battle, when Gonggong gave the order, Xiangliu and Floating immediately took action. Xiangliu, that giant monster with nine snake bodies, each head can spew surging floods; Floating is characterized by a floating body, shuttling between rivers, lakes, and seas. They worked together to pull up all the water from the Three Rivers and Five Seas. In an instant, the turbid waves in the sky hung upside down like the Milky Way, with black waves surging and blocking the sky. The pure white clouds were instantly swallowed up, and the divine fire ignited by Zhurong gradually dimmed in this towering flood.
But is Fire God Zhurong someone who easily surrenders? He wielded the blazing dragon all over his body and faced it with great majesty. When the flood receded, he muttered words and called for the help of the Wind God. A fierce wind howled up, carrying flames. Fire borrowed the wind's momentum, and the wind aided its power. After a fierce battle, the Fire God Zhurong, representing brightness, achieved a complete victory. Floating eyes watched helplessly as the defeat was settled, both angry and anxious, living and dying with vitality; Xiangliu saw the situation was not good and quickly turned into a wisp of green smoke, fleeing away. At this moment, Gonggong was already exhausted, looking at the defeated soldiers in front of him, filled with unwillingness and despair, and had to flee to the end of the sky in embarrassment.
Gonggong ran wildly all the way, I don't know how long it took, and finally arrived at the foot of Buzhou Mountain. He turned around and saw that Zhu Rong's pursuers were already within reach. Gonggong felt both ashamed and angry in his heart, ashamed of his disastrous defeat and angry at the injustice of fate. He let out a long howl in the sky, a hint of determination flashing in his eyes, and then used all his strength to charge towards the mountainside. With a loud bang, the Bu Zhou Mountain that supported the sky was actually knocked over by him.
In an instant, half of the sky collapsed with a loud bang, revealing a huge, rocky hole. The water of Tianhe poured down from the cave, like ten thousand galloping horses, and the flood instantly submerged the earth. Fields, villages, and mountains have all been engulfed by floods, causing people to be displaced and crying uncontrollably. The disaster caused by the conflict between water and fire plunged the world into endless darkness and despair. And this is the origin of the famous allusion of 'incompatible water and fire'.
Fortunately, the great N ü wa could not bear to see the people suffer. She traveled around, collected colorful stones, and set up furnaces on Kunlun Mountain to refine them day and night. Finally, N ü wa filled the hole in the sky with refined five colored stones, severed the four legs of the divine turtle to support the sky, and stopped the flood with reed ash. From then on, the earth returned to peace and the world regained vitality once again.
